Guest warwound
Can you tell me how to properly pack the ROM after deleting the non-required APKs and install the same ??

If you open the ROM zip with WinZip and go to the folder system/app now select any apps that you want to remove.

Right click the selected apps and select Delete.

Now simply close the zip file and try to flash - WinZip should save the modified zip file correctly this way.

Creating a new zip archive rather than modifying the original has never worked for me.

Can you tell me how to properly pack the ROM after deleting the non-required APKs and install the same ??

you can't extract and re-pack the zip file it simply doesn't work that way.

If you want to remove the APK files then open the zip and just delete the files from the zip itself. Do not extract it first, simply open it.

Close Winzip (or whatever you are using) and flash in CWM.
